Add 7/42 and 49/6

1st number: 7/42, 2nd number: 8 1/6

7/42 + 49/6 is 25/3.

Steps for adding fractions

  1.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
    LCM of 42 and 6 is 42

    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 42
  2. For the 1st fraction, since 42 × 1 = 42,
    7/42 = 7 × 1/42 × 1 = 7/42
  3.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 6 × 7 = 42,
    49/6 = 49 × 7/6 × 7 = 343/42
  4. Add the two like fractions:
    7/42 + 343/42 = 7 + 343/42 = 350/42
  5. 350/42 simplified gives 25/3
  6. So, 7/42 + 49/6 = 25/3
